The intrepid wont be back for a few weeks at least. Skip coney island now that the summer is over. Empire state is a good choice as well as any of the museums. As far as the WTC site you can view it from the financial buildings on the west side. Ive never seen a tour available that takes you on site but it may be possible.

Personal reccomendations would be pubs(if training allows) and food. NYC is pretty much the center of the universe when it comes to drinkin and eatin.
